London: A footage of British boy band One Direction's shelved music video for their single Infinity leaked online, reports aceshowbiz.com.
In the brief video clip, the band members are seen performing in what looks like a parking lot while the song plays in the background. (Also Read: One Direction Will Take Break But Not Split, Say Members)
Behind them is a massive white backdrop featuring their faces drawn among other images seemingly created by fans.
Written by Julian Bunetta, John Ryan and Jamie Scott, Infinity first released in September last year as a countdown single preceding the release of One Direction's fifth studio effort.
Because of that reason, some fans expressed their disappointment on Twitter after it was announced that the song would be the group's next official single.
